aacs: rename decrypt.rs->content.rs, variants.rs->variant.rs (no logic change)
Pure file+module-path rename. 'content' names the AACS unit-decrypt layer (distinct from the top-level sector-decrypt driver crate::decrypt), and 'variant' (singular, spec term 'Media Key Variant') names the 2.1 chain. Logic-hash identical to baseline; 277 items intact; tests green.
